Abstract :
Texture image retrieval system using contourlet transform has better performance than the same structure system based on wavelet transform due to contourlet´s better directional information representation than wavelet transform. In order to improve the retrieval rate further, a dual-tree complex contourlet transform based texture image retrieval system was proposed in this paper. In the system, the dual tree contourlet transform was used to transform each image into contourlet domain and implemented multiscale decomposition, sub-bands energy, standard deviations and skewness in contourlet domain were cascaded to form feature vectors, and the similarity metric used here is Canberra distance. Experimental results on brodatz test images set show that dual tree contourlet transform based image retrieval system is superior to those of the original contourlet transform, non-subsampled contourlet transform under the same system structure with almost same length of feature vectors, retrieval time and memory needed; and contourlet decomposition structure parameter can make significant effects on retrieval rates, especially scale number.
